The answer is: 26.6833281283 Answer: To calculate the square root of any number without a calculator is a lot of work - not really worth the trouble. Anyway, here is one method. Make an initial estimate for the square root; since 20 squared is 400 and 30 squared is 900, it must be somewhere in between. Let's say we take 20 as our initial guess. Try dividing 712 / 20. The result is 35.6. Now, since 20 x 35.6 = 712, the real square root must be somewhere between those two factors. You might take the average, but for now I'll use 30 as an approximation. Repeat: 712 / 30 = 23.73. Once again, the real square root is somewhere between 30 and 23.73. The average (rounded to the nearest integer) is 27. Repeat with this number: 712 / 27 = 26.37. Taking the average of 27 and 26.37, you get 26.69. Repeat, using 26.69 as the new estimate for the square root. With every step, the number of significant digits in the estimation should more or less double.
